Depends entirely on the specific requirements of the government contracts you're dealing with. Outlaw does have features that manage government contracts, but you'll need to evaluate how well it aligns with your particular compliance needs. One key aspect of Outlaw is its ability to manage contract lifecycles. This means you can track every step of a contract, from drafting and approval to execution and compliance monitoring. The software supports various types of contracts, including specialty and government contracts, which is important for organizations that need to follow specific regulatory standards. For example, if your business involves federal contracts, Outlaw's document management capabilities let you keep all necessary documentation in one place, making it easier to confirm compliance. You can attach compliance documents directly to tasks, which helps track and manage requirements throughout the contract lifecycle. Version control and audit trails also maintain transparency and accountability, which are often critical in government contracting. This makes Outlaw a good fit for businesses engaging in government contracts, especially if you have a dedicated team focused on compliance. However, assess whether Outlaw covers all your specific compliance requirements, particularly if you deal with complex regulatory frameworks. One trade-off is that Outlaw may not have extensive features designed for highly specialized government contracts that require unique compliance tracking. If your needs are more niche, you might need to supplement Outlaw with additional compliance management tools. Talk with your compliance team to define your exact needs and use cases. This will help you determine how well Outlaw can meet your requirements for managing government contracts and whether additional tools are necessary.
